Turning the power on/off
Turning the power on
1. Slide toward until the display becomes active.
After the Startup Screen is shown, the Home Screen will open on the display.
The first time the power is turned on after purchase as well as when the H1essential has been reset
to factory defaults, setting screens for the guide sound, display language and date and time will be
shown. Make these settings. (→ Setting the guide sound (first time starting up), Setting the language
shown (first time starting up), Setting the date format (first time starting up), Setting the date and time
(first time starting up), Setting the type of batteries used (first time starting up))
NOTE
The H1essential can be set so that its power will automatically turn off if it is not used for a set amount of
time. (→ Setting the time until the power turns off automatically)
If “No SD Card!” appears on the display, confirm that a microSD card is inserted properly. (→ Inserting
microSD cards)
If “Invalid SD Card!” appears on the display, the card is not formatted correctly. Format the microSD card
or use a different microSD card. (→ Formatting microSD cards, Inserting microSD cards)
